Get PriceMineral exploration is the process of searching for evidence of any mineralisation hosted in the surrounding rocks The general principle works by extracting pieces of geological information from several places and extrapolating this over the larger area to develop a geological picture Exploration works in stages of increasing sophistication

Get PriceA lease grants the exclusive right to develop and mine Alberta owned metallic and industrial minerals in a specified location The term of a lease is 15 years and it may be renewed Annual rent must be paid Royalties must be paid if any mineral production takes place on the lease for additional information please refer to the Mining Tool Kit
